The arithmetic, on Quinsigamond Community College's own numbers. Net price $9,090 × 2 years = $18,180 total. Median earnings $45,949 fall $2,411 short of the $48,360 high-school baseline, so the premium this formula divides by is not positive and no break-even year exists on institution-wide pay. A programme here earning $58,360 would clear the $18,180 bill in about 1.8 years — the gap, not the price, is what blocks payback. Full method.

How much debt do Quinsigamond Community College students graduate with?

A median $16,575 in federal loans among completers, or 36% of the $45,949 its graduates earn ten years out — our math. The figure excludes private loans and students who left before finishing.

What share of Quinsigamond Community College students graduate?

22% finish their degree — 78% leave carrying the cost without the credential. Spread the $18,180 bill across that completion rate and the cohort pays $82,636 per graduate produced — our math, and the figure a payback number never shows.

Is Quinsigamond Community College expensive compared with other Massachusetts colleges?

Its $9,090 net price runs $15,793 below the $24,883 median across the 85 Massachusetts colleges we profile, and $31,586 less across the full degree.
